How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Coastal Brevard?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Coastal Brevard Studio Apartments | $1,428 | $920 | $2,464 |
| Coastal Brevard 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,654 | $1,000 | $5,221 |
| Coastal Brevard 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,012 | $577 | $8,025 |
| Coastal Brevard 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,035 | $1,453 | $10,000+ |
| Coastal Brevard 4 Bedroom Apartments | $9,139 | $4,311 | $10,000+ |
| Coastal Brevard 5 Bedroom Apartments | $10,145 | $6,046 | $10,000+ |
